Strange But True: Free Loan From Social Security (2024)

Disclaimer: The U.S. Social Security Administration substantially limited the use of the “free loan” strategy in 2010, seepress release|federal ruling

The brief’s key findings are:

  • An unconventional strategy allows individuals to use early Social Security benefits like a “free loan,” paying back the principal while keeping the interest.
  • If this strategy were widely adopted, it would cost Social Security $6 billion to $11 billion per year today and more in the future.
  • The strategy primarily benefits higher income individuals, who have the financial resources to invest their benefits and tend to be in better health.

Can you get a one time loan from Social Security? ›

We may pay a one-time emergency advance payment to an individual initially applying for benefits who is presumptively eligible for SSI benefits and who has a financial emergency.

Does Social Security give cash advances? ›

WHO CAN RECEIVE AN EMERGENCY ADVANCE PAYMENT? Are due SSI benefits (including PD or PB payments) that are delayed or not received. Are facing a "financial emergency", which means they need money right away due to a threat to health or safety, such as not enough money for food, clothing, shelter, or medical care.

What is the Social Security 5 year rule? ›

The Social Security five-year rule is the time period in which you can file for an expedited reinstatement after your Social Security disability benefits have been terminated completely due to work.

Can I withdraw money from my Social Security number? ›

A recent hoax circulating on the internet asserts that the Federal Reserve maintains accounts for individuals that are tied to the individual's Social Security number, and that individuals can access these accounts to pay bills and obtain money. These claims are false.
